This is a complete set of short comprehension quizzes for the 2024 short story collection Flying Lessons & Other Stories edited by Ellen Oh and is part of Unit 1 of the 2024 Grade 6 CKLA Curriculum. There is one quiz for each of the ten stories, and quizzes for the Foreword and Editor's Note are also included. WebFlying Lessons, edited by Ellen Oh – Meg Medina. WebJan 3, 2024 · In FLYING LESSONS AND OTHER STORIES 10 celebrated authors create short stories for kids in a variety of genres and reflecting a variety of perspectives. Some stories focus on sports or family; others …
